Output 21c80d2e9bf0e6519bb90116146ee50868345282a70b3cab73749d956d8d7209:3

value
327090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ebdb6f1bf8733047b31a758ac0bd5927738051f OP_EQUAL
address
3BnZXFMx1UCwzdEHjn4CFQBc2Ya2R6VGVJ
transaction
21c80d2e9bf0e6519bb90116146ee50868345282a70b3cab73749d956d8d7209
spent
true